In a somewhat surprising turn of events, Ville Heinola has become the first 2019 draftee to score an NHL goal, beating Kappo Kakko and Jack Hughes to the punch. Heinola, the 20th overall pick this past June, seems to be making the most of his opportunity to jump straight into the NHL in his draft year. His early arrival may be due to the fact that the Winnipeg Jets are in dire need of blueliners, but Heinola does not appear to be struggling to find his stride in the early going, as is evidenced by his ability to find his way on the scoresheet on Tuesday night in Pittsburgh. Heinola also has two helpers, bringing his total to 3 points in the first four games of his young NHL career.

The plot thickens in Pittsburgh as Alex Galchenyuk and Patric Hornqvist are both listed as day-to-day with lower-body injuries, joining Bryan Rust, Evgeni Malkin and Nick Bjugstad on the sidelines. Hornqvist's injury occurred during Tuesday night's game vs the Winnipeg Jets. Galchenyuk's injury is the same nagging injury that held him out during the exhibition schedule.

After brief concern that Dmitry Orlov may miss tomorrow's game in Nashville after leaving practice early with a lower-body injury, Todd Reirden has confirmed that Orlov is indeed expected to play. Michal Kempny, however, is not. Kempny will travel with the team, but will not suit up against the Preds. His status for Saturday's game in Dallas is still unknown.
